Mailreef's bounce processor parses untrusted inbound payloads. All limits are enforced before parsing. Oversized messages are dropped, not truncated. Per-sender rate limits prevent a hostile relay from flooding the suppression list. Header counts, MIME depth, and attachment expansion are each bounded independently; exceeding any one rejects the message. Quota breaches emit audit events but never retry. Review focus: confirm no path bypasses these checks. Current enforcement values are given by the constants below.

tuning table, kajog-kawef:
PRIORITIES = {
    "kelox": 870,
    "kasix": 89,
    "eliax": 988,
}

### Step 4: Rebuild the tax-rate lookup cache

Before cutting traffic to Ledgewell v3, warm the tax-rate cache or the first requests will hammer the Calvano rates API. Run the warmer job, confirm hit rates exceed 95%, and only then flip the router. The warmer job expects the following configuration values.

settings of fafog-haduf:
ZORIX_PIN=4648
ZORIX_METRICS_HOST=metrics.zorix.paliqsys.corp
ZORIX_LOG_LEVEL=info
ZORIX_TENANT=druix

## Authentication

Heads up: the nightly reindex job (`reindex_nightly.py`) talks to the Lanternfish search cluster, and that cluster won't accept anonymous writes anymore — we locked it down last sprint. The job now authenticates as the `reindex-runner` service identity against Corvid Gateway, and the token is injected via the `LF_INDEX_TOKEN` env var in the scheduler config. Nothing clever going on, just a bearer header on every batch request. For review purposes, the staging credential currently in use is listed below.

service key, kadug-kadup: kto15_rN23XLAYImmZgrJ

Step 4: Catalogue import for the Marlowe Public Reading Network. Run the Shelfwright importer against the nightly MARC export, then check the reconciliation report for duplicate accession records. Anything over 0.5% duplicates means the dedupe pass failed — stop and rerun stage two. When the import completes cleanly, note the build token shown below in the shift log.

session token of kahif-kageg = htk14_01cd78718aea51